Sense Emotion (Creature)
Casting Time: 1 Round Range: 10m Duration: Instantaneous MP Cost: 2
You detect the most prevalent emotional state of the creature, for example: happy, sad, angry, scared, disgusted, excited, etc. If the creature has no emotions or is somehow suppressing them, all you get is "neutral".
